LMV393MM Frequently Asked Questions (FAQs)

  • The maximum voltage that can be applied to the input pins is the supply voltage (VCC) + 0.3V. Exceeding this voltage can cause damage to the device.
  • To prevent oscillation, add hysteresis to the input signal by adding a small amount of positive feedback from the output to the non-inverting input. This helps to ensure a clean transition between the high and low output states.
  • The minimum input voltage required for the comparator to function correctly is 1.9V. Operating the device below this voltage may result in incorrect output states or oscillations.
  • No, the LMV393MM is a comparator, not an amplifier. It is designed to compare two input voltages and output a digital signal indicating which input is higher. It is not intended for amplifying small signals.
  • To reduce power consumption, consider using a lower supply voltage (VCC) or reducing the frequency of the input signal. You can also use a lower-power comparator or consider using a low-power mode if available.

About Texas Instruments

Texas Instruments (TI) designs and manufactures semiconductors and integrated circuits for a wide range of applications. The company's product portfolio includes analog chips, which are essential for managing power and signal functions in electronic devices, and embedded processors, which serve as the brains in various systems, enabling functionality in everything from industrial equipment to consumer electronics. TI's innovations in semiconductor technology have made it a leader in the industry.
